Body of InfoWars Reporter Found in Parking Lot

InfoWars correspondent Jamie White was tragically killed near his residence in Austin, Texas, on Sunday night, as reported by the media outlet. The news was disclosed by Alex Jones, the founder of InfoWars, in a statement released on Monday. Jones expressed profound sorrow over the incident, attributing White’s death in part to the policies of Soros Austin, Texas District Attorney, Jose Garza.

Jones pledged that White’s untimely demise would not be in vain and vowed to ensure that the perpetrators of this heinous act would face justice. He remembered White as an exceptional writer and a close friend who had been a part of the InfoWars team for many years.

White was returning home from work on Sunday night when the incident occurred, as per Jones’ account. The Austin Police Department, however, has not yet commented on the matter. Local Fox 7 reported that the police found an adult male with visible signs of trauma in South Austin around midnight on Sunday. The victim was rushed to the hospital, where he succumbed to his injuries.

The victim was discovered in an apartment complex parking lot, according to a report by KXAN. Investigators were seen collecting evidence from a second-floor apartment, the report added. Jones, in a monologue on Monday, described the scene, stating that there was blood scattered across the parking lot.

The police have not released any information about the suspect but confirmed that an investigation is in progress. This incident marks the eighth homicide in Austin this year.
